Job Description

Associate Software Engineer

Forbes Advisor

Role Description - Full-Stack Development & Maintenance - Build and maintain features across our Next.js frontends and FastAPI backends. - Support the ongoing maintenance of our production tool suite — bug fixes, small enhancements, data validation, and monitoring. - Write clean, testable Python and TypeScript code. - Data Pipelines & Automation - Build and maintain pipelines connecting third-party APIs (SEMrush, ScrapingBee, and similar) to our LLM workflows. - Set up and manage scheduled jobs using AWS ECS Scheduled Tasks, EventBridge, and Redis-based job queues. - Support data validation and quality checks across tools. - AI/LLM Integration - Work with OpenAI and Anthropic APIs to integrate LLM functionality into tools. - Support prompt iteration and testing under the team's guidance. - Build familiarity with AI evaluation ("evals") concepts as the team develops these further. - Cloud & Infrastructure (AWS) - Get hands-on with AWS services used in our stack: ECS, ALB, S3, RDS, EventBridge. - Support deployment, monitoring, and troubleshooting of services running in ECS. - Tooling & Ways of Working - Use AI-assisted development tools (Cursor, Claude, Copilot, etc.) as part of the daily workflow. - Collaborate closely with the Lead Innovation Engineer and, at times, with stakeholders from other teams (SEO, Content, etc.) to understand requirements. Qualifications -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field. - Must-Have Technical Skills - 1.5+ years of professional experience. - Solid foundation in Python; some exposure to FastAPI or a similar framework (Flask/Django) is a plus. - Working knowledge of JavaScript/TypeScript; exposure to React/Next.js. - Basic understanding of SQL and relational databases. - Basic understanding of REST APIs and asynchronous programming concepts. - Comfortable using AI coding assistants (Cursor, Copilot, Claude, etc.) as part of daily development. - Working knowledge of Git/GitHub (branching, PRs, code reviews) and a basic understanding of CI/CD pipelines. - Good to Have (not required, but a plus) - Any prior exposure to OpenAI/Anthropic APIs. - Basic familiarity with AWS (any service) or any cloud provider. - Exposure to Redis or job queuing/background task concepts (e.g., RQ, Celery, or similar). - Some exposure to AI agents or agentic workflows. - Exposure to web scraping, data pipelines, or automation. - Soft Skills - Curious and eager to learn — this role will expose you to fast-moving areas of AI tooling. - Good communication skills; comfortable asking questions and flagging blockers early. - Organized and able to manage multiple small tasks/tools at once. - Comfortable working in a small, fast-paced team with high ownership. Benefits - Remote-first and flexible — work from anywhere in India with global exposure. - Monthly long weekends (every third Friday off). - Generous wellness stipends and parental leave. - A collaborative team where your voice is heard and your work drives real impact.

Role Description GroundTruth is a location-based advertising and measurement company. You'll join the engineering team that builds the large-scale, high-traffic backend systems at the core of our advertising platform — distributed, real-time services where performance, efficiency, and reliability are first-class concerns, not afterthoughts. This is a hands-on backend role for someone who likes systems with real constraints and fast feedback. You'll design and ship production services, dig into how they behave under load, and make changes you can measure. It's a good fit if you care about getting things right and enjoy working close to the parts of a system where decisions actually show up in the numbers. You will: - Design, build, and operate backend services that run reliably at scale — yours from first commit through production. - Work with distributed systems, concurrency, and asynchronous processing — and the failure modes that come with them. - Profile and tune for performance and efficiency, where the right data structure or a single removed bottleneck makes the difference. - Take an ambiguous production symptom and reason your way to the root cause. - Integrate with caching, streaming, and data-storage systems — and instrument your services so they stay debuggable when something breaks. - Ship in small, reviewable increments through automated pipelines, and leave the code clearer than you found it. Qualifications - 3-5 years building production backend systems — strong in Scala or Java, plus comfort writing Python for tooling, automation, and data work. - Real depth in data structures and algorithms — you reach for the right structure instinctively and can reason about time and space cost, not just recite Big-O. - A solid grasp of concurrency and asynchronous programming — and the discipline that high-throughput systems demand. - Fluency with CI/CD. You treat automated build, test, and deployment pipelines as part of building the feature — not a separate chore — and you know how to ship safely and roll back fast when something's off. - AI fluency, especially with coding agents. You already build with tools like Claude Code or Codex — not as a gimmick, but to move faster, take on larger changes, and reason about unfamiliar code. - Sharp problem-solving and critical thinking. You question assumptions — including your own — before committing to a fix, and you can defend a decision on its merits. - Strong ownership. You own what you ship end to end: you don't toss code over the wall, and "not my service" isn't in your vocabulary. - A genuine learning habit. The people who do well here are the ones still curious about how things actually work — the ones who chase a question past the point where they strictly had to, because they want the real answer. - A multiplier on the team. Clear pull requests, honest and kind reviews, and no hero complex — you make the engineers around you better. Requirements - Experience operating large-scale, performance-sensitive systems in production. - Exposure to AWS, especially Auto Scaling Groups, EC2, ELB, and ElastiCache. - Hands-on with AWS Bedrock and Bedrock AgentCore (or comparable LLM/agent frameworks) — an area we're actively investing in. - A background in ad-tech or programmatic advertising. - A little frontend (HTML/CSS/JS or a modern framework) — the least important item here, but handy for internal tooling.
